renew: Florida Gators Redshirt Freshman Quarterback Jalen Kittner Posted a $80,000 bond, according to Edgar Thompson of the Orlando Sentinel and was released from the Alachua County Jail Thursday night.
Kitna is no longer listed as a “person in custody,” and his profile has been removed from the Alachua County Sheriff’s Office prisoner search, according to the Alachua County Circuit Court clerk.
Kitna’s bail was set at her first court appearance on Thursday. He faces five preliminary charges related to child pornography: two counts of second-degree distribution of child exploitation material and three counts of third-degree possession of child pornography.
renew: Florida Gators Redshirt Freshman Quarterback Jalen Kittner He made his first appearance in Alachua County Court on Thursday after being arrested Wednesday on five preliminary felony charges related to possession and distribution of child pornography.
Kitna appeared on a video stream from the Alachua County Jail. His parents, Jon and Jennifer Kitna, and his priest all appeared in court.
Kitna’s bond was set at $80,000, according to WUFT-Gainesville, although his attorney, Caleb Kenyon, requested that Kitna be released without bail, claiming that no one was directly harmed by Kitna’s alleged actions.
Kitna previously admitted to sharing two images containing child sexual abuse material on the social media site Discord in an interview with Gainesville Police Department Detective Donna Montague. A search warrant for Kitna on Wednesday found three other images of child sexual abuse material in his possession after an initial analysis of Kitna’s electronic devices.
Alachua County Court Judge Meshon T. Rawls denied Kenyon’s request and ordered Kitna not to use the Internet or have unsupervised contact with minors.
If convicted on those charges — the state attorney’s office will decide in the coming weeks whether to formally file criminal charges, after his initial charge read out three counts of possessing child pornography and two counts of distributing child exploitation material — Kitna Faces up to 45 years in prison and a $35,000 fine.
Kitna was wearing a dark green sleeveless gown, which indicated he was on suicide watch during his court appearance, according to WUFT officials.
renew: Florida Gators Redshirt Freshman Quarterback Jalen Kittner was charged Wednesday with three counts of possessing child pornography and two counts of distributing child exploitation material, the latter two charges being second-degree felonies, according to a statement from the Gainesville Police Department.
A search warrant was served at Kitner’s Gainesville residence Wednesday morning after receiving an online tip from the National Center for Missing and Exploited Children, according to a police statement.

Investigating further, Gainesville Police Department Detective Donna Montague discovered that two images containing child sexual abuse material were shared from Kitner’s address to the social media site Discord. The investigation also revealed that the likely Discord account holder was Kitna.
Kitna’s electronic devices were seized as part of the search warrant. Following an initial analysis of the devices, three additional images of child sexual abuse material were found.
UF issued the following statement Wednesday afternoon, acknowledging that Kitna had been suspended indefinitely.
“We are appalled and saddened to hear of the news involving Jalen Kitna. These are extremely serious allegations and the University of Florida and the UAA have zero tolerance for such conduct.
“Jaylen has been suspended indefinitely.”
